MySQL数据库创建表出现乱码问题可能是由于以下原因引起的:
SHOW VARIABLES LIKE 'character_set_database';
获取。
b. 确认应用程序连接数据库时的字符集,可以在连接数据库的代码中设置字符集,例如在PHP中可以使用mysqli_set_charset($conn, 'utf8');
进行设置。
c. 确认创建表时的字符集,可以在创建表的语句中指定字符集,例如CREATE TABLE table_name (column_name VARCHAR(255)) DEFAULT CHARSET=utf8;
。mysqli_set_charset($conn, 'utf8');
,来解决该问题。在解决乱码问题时,可以借助腾讯云提供的MySQL云数据库解决方案,例如腾讯云的云数据库MySQL版(https://cloud.tencent.com/product/cdb_mysql)和云数据库MariaDB版(https://cloud.tencent.com/product/cdb_mariadb),它们提供了可靠的数据库存储和管理服务,并支持自动备份和容灾能力,以保证数据的安全性和可用性。此外,腾讯云还提供了适用于不同规模和需求的云数据库解决方案,如分布式数据库TDSQL(https://cloud.tencent.com/product/tdsql)、高可用云数据库TBase(https://cloud.tencent.com/product/tbase)等,可根据实际情况选择相应的产品。
领取专属 10元无门槛券
手把手带您无忧上云